National para archer Suresh qualifies for Phuket semis
National para archer S. Suresh advances to the semi-finals after scoring 611 points to finish second in the qualifying round, five points behind Thailand’s Hanreuchai Netsiri. – Raaga (Malaysia) Facebook pic, March 25, 2022

KUALA LUMPUR – National para archer S. Suresh has qualified for the semi-finals of the men’s recurve event at the Phuket Asia Para Archery Tournament 2022 in Thailand.

Suresh, 28, advanced after accumulating 611 points to finish second in the qualifying round today.

He scored 299 points from the 70m distance in the first set before doing even better with 312 points in the second set.

He finished just five points behind Thailand’s Hanreuchai Netsiri (616 pts), whose compatriot Pornchai Phimthong (571 pts) was third.

Suresh, who was named the National Paralympic Sportsman at the 2019/2020 National Sports Award (ASN) on Tuesday (March 22), is set to face Phimthong in the semi-finals tomorrow. – Bernama, March 25, 2022
